<description>&#60;p&#62;SecretSync requires that you have Java version 1.6.0 or newer on your system in order to run. If you can't update or install Java for the entire system, i.e. if you don't have admin privileges, you can still run SecretSync by installing a copy of the Java runtime into the SecretSync folder.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If you try and run SecretSync and get the following message --&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;'This application requires a Java Runtime Environment 1.6.0'&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;You don't have the appropriate Java version. It may be older, or not installed, etc. To install a local version that SecretSync should run ok with, do the following steps.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Download jPortable from: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;http://portableapps.com/apps/utilities/java_portable&#34;&#62;http://portableapps.com/apps/utilities/java_portable&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Run and extract it to &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;%APPDATA%\SecretSync\Java&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;%APPDATA% corresponds to the following directory on XP: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;C:\Documents and Settings\&#38;lt;USERNAME&#38;gt;\Application Data\SecretSync\Java&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Or the following directory on Windows 7/Vista: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;C:\Users\&#38;lt;USERNAME&#38;gt;\AppData\Roaming\SecretSync\Java&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If SecretSync can find the Java runtime at the above location, it will be able to run.

<description>&#60;p&#62;Right-click on the following link and choose Save As, then save this batch file to your Desktop.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/help/manual.bat&#34; rel=&#34;nofollow&#34;&#62;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/help/manual.bat&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Then open your Desktop in Explorer and double-click on the &#60;code&#62;manual.bat&#60;/code&#62; file. This will run SecretSync directly from the command-line. If you encounter any errors, please email them to &#60;strong&#62;support @ completelyprivatefiles.com&#60;/strong&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Errors may be logged in &#60;code&#62;error.txt&#60;/code&#62; which can be located, on Win7/Vista in&#60;/p&#62;

<description>&#60;p&#62;We've just discovered a cool little web-based storage company called &#60;a href=&#34;http://www.mydrive.ch/&#34;&#62;MyDrive.ch&#60;/a&#62;, based out of Sweden, that not only provide a web interface to manage your files, but also lets you map a drive using WebDAV to access your files. MyDrive.ch offers 2 GB of data storage free, and are the property of &#60;a href=&#34;http://www.softronics.ch/en/about-us/about-us.php&#34;&#62;this company&#60;/a&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Since MyDrive.ch provides WebDAV support, you can use SecretSync with it. It's pretty easy to setup. First, you'll need to sign-up for an account with MyDrive.ch.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Then, you'll need to follow their instructions to map a local drive to your MyDrive.ch account. The instructions can be found &#60;a href=&#34;http://www.mydrive.ch/help#webdav&#34;&#62;&#60;strong&#62;here&#60;/strong&#62;&#60;/a&#62;.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;The following demonstrates setting up on the Windows System, using NetDrive, per the recommendation of MyDrive.ch.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;After installing NetDrive, you can map a drive letter on Windows to your MyDrive.ch account. Here's a screenshot.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/forum-mydrive-netdrive.png&#34; alt=&#34;NetDrive map to MyDrive.ch WebDAV&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Next, you need to download and install SecretSync. When it asks for the Dropbox, etc, folder, give it the drive letter you mapped using NetDrive. In our case, this was &#60;code&#62;Z:\&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/forum-mydrive-secretsync-install.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ync tunnel folder MyDrive.ch&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Finish the install, and then you can use SecretSync as you normally would. Put a file in, it encrypts it and uploads it to the &#60;code&#62;Z:\&#60;/code&#62; drive, which goes to your MyDrive.ch account.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;E.g. here's the contents of the SecretSync folder: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/forum-mydrive-secretsync.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ync with MyDrive.ch&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;And here's the corresponding data in our MyDrive.ch account.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/forum-mydrive-mydrive.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ync with MyDrive.ch&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Since WebDAV works in a cross-platform way, you should be able to setup this configuration on multiple platforms and synchronize your files in total privacy and security.

<description>&#60;p&#62;SecretSync was designed to be simple and work between two locations, usually folders, on your hard drive. In this way, it is able to be used with your choice of synchronization service, whether Dropbox, Ubuntu One, or SugarSync.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Now, there's another alternative. You can be your own cloud provider, by using &#60;a href=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com&#34;&#62;SecretSync&#60;/a&#62; with &#60;a href=&#34;http://tntdrive.com&#34;&#62;TntDrive&#60;/a&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;TntDrive is cool utility that maps a Windows drive letter to a bucket in Amazon S3. (Just FYI, S3 is the service Dropbox uses to actually store your data online.) Then, anything you put in the mapped drive is uploaded to S3. You can then map the drive from a second PC, and you have your own cloud-based file sharing.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;To add strong client-side encryption and synchronization, add SecretSync to the mix. Then you can point your &#60;strong&#62;destination (or tunnel folder)&#60;/strong&#62; folder to the mapped drive, and you have DIY encrypted synchronization.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Here's how to get started: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;TntDrive will prompt you for your Amazon S3 account, so you'll need to &#60;a href=&#34;https://aws.amazon.com/&#34;&#62;sign-up for one first&#60;/a&#62;. After you've signed-up, you'll need to create a bucket. I called mine &#60;em&#62;secretsync&#60;/em&#62;: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/secretsync-tntdrive-fig0.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ync TntDrive&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;After that, you're ready to go. Map the drive using TntDrive. It will ask for your Amazon security credentials. Then, it will ask for your S3 account (different than the security credentials) and the bucket you've set up: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/secretsync-tntdrive-fig1.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ync TntDrive&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;After you have the drive mapped, and have verified that you can save files to it successfully, &#60;strong&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/download/#windows&#34;&#62;install SecretSync&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/strong&#62;. When it prompts for the &#60;strong&#62;destination or tunnel folder&#60;/strong&#62;, choose the mapped drive. In our case, this was drive &#60;code&#62;Z:\&#60;/code&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Then, use SecretSync as you normally would. Put a file in the &#60;code&#62;S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; folder, and you'll see its encrypted version in the TntDrive: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/secretsync-tntdrive-fig2.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ync TntDrive&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;There you have it. Roll-your-own secure sync.

&#60;p&#62;SecretSync was designed to be versatile, and work with any folder on your system. A case in point: you can use it with &#60;strong&#62;Microsoft LiveMesh&#60;/strong&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;strong&#62;Microsoft&#60;/strong&#62; has their own Dropbox-like offering called &#60;strong&#62;LiveMesh&#60;/strong&#62;. It works in largely the same manner as Dropbox, by letting you choose a folder on your system, and then synchronizing that folder to the LiveMesh cloud. It has a nice 5 GB free option, too.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Once you install LiveMesh and select a folder to sync (we chose &#60;code&#62;Documents\LiveMesh&#60;/code&#62;), you can easily point SecretSync to this location as your tunnel folder.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;We created the &#60;code&#62;Documents\LiveMesh\_SecretSync_tunnel_Root&#60;/code&#62; sub-folder as our tunnel folder when we installed SecretSync.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Everything in this folder will be encrypted. LiveMesh will then sync the encrypted files to your other systems.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Here's our text file in the &#60;code&#62;S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; folder: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/forum-ss-livemesh.png&#34; alt=&#34;SecretSync with Microsoft LiveMesh&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;And here it is after SecretSync has encrypted and added it to LiveMesh:&#60;/p&#62;

<description>&#60;p&#62;If during uninstall of SecretSync you mistakenly select the &#60;strong&#62;Delete SecretSync tunnel folder&#60;/strong&#62; option (despite the warning), i.e.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/secretsync-del-tunnel.png&#34; alt=&#34;&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;your SecretSync data will be removed from Dropbox, and will as a &#60;strong&#62;result be deleted on any other computer that is synchronizing with this computer&#60;/strong&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If all computers in the sync chain synchronize this deletion, the only possibility for recovery is to use the Dropbox recovery option. We cannot guarantee that this will work, but some users have recovered their data in this manner.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Log in with your account to &#60;a href=&#34;http://dropbpox.com&#34;&#62;dropbox.com&#60;/a&#62; and click &#60;em&#62;Show deleted files&#60;/em&#62;. If &#60;code&#62;.SecretSync_tunnel_Root&#60;/code&#62; appears, check to restore it.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/dropbox-deleted-files.png&#34; alt=&#34;&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If you re-install SecretSync and it detects this folder, it will copy-decrypt the files into the local SecretSync folder.

<description>&#60;p&#62;&#60;strong&#62;Note:&#60;/strong&#62; If you're doing this in order to perform a clean reinstall, it is recommended that you backup all the data in the &#60;code&#62;S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; folder first. &#60;strong&#62;Do this as a precaution, in case there are any issues, so none of your data is lost&#60;/strong&#62;. Simply copy all the files in the &#60;code&#62;S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; folder to an alternate location, like your Documents folder.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;To uninstall, download this archive,&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/help/SecretSync-uninstall.zip&#34; rel=&#34;nofollow&#34;&#62;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/help/SecretSync-uninstall.zip&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;extract the contents and double-click on the 'SecretSync-uninstall' app. Once the service has been removed, you should get a pop-up telling you so.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;strong&#62;Note:&#60;/strong&#62; This does not remove the &#60;code&#62;Dropbox/.SecretSync_tunnel_Root&#60;/code&#62; folder, since you may be synchronizing other machines. If you are removing SecretSync everywhere, you will need to manually delete the &#60;code&#62;.SecretSync_tunnel_Root&#60;/code&#62; folder from Dropbox. &#60;strong&#62;Just be aware that by manually deleting the .SecretSync_tunnel_Root will cause your data to be gone from all computers in the sync chain&#60;/strong&#62;

<description>&#60;p&#62;To uninstall SecretSync completely from OS X (especially in the case of a problem, where you plan to re-install), please follow these instructions closely: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(1) Backup all the data in the SecretSync folder first. &#60;strong&#62;Do this as a precaution, in case there are any issues, so none of your data is lost.&#60;/strong&#62; Simply copy all the files in the &#60;code&#62;S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; folder to an alternate location, like your &#60;code&#62;Documents&#60;/code&#62; folder.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(2) Stop SecretSync. You must make sure the SecretSync process is not running on your computer.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(a) Open Applications in Finder, and click &#60;code&#62;SecretSync Service Stop&#60;/code&#62;, i.e.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;img src=&#34;http://getsecretsync.com/ss/images/support-osx-ss-stop.png&#34; alt=&#34;stop secretsync&#34; /&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(b) Just to be sure no errant processes are still running, open &#60;code&#62;Terminal&#60;/code&#62; (most of the following steps will be done in Terminal anyway), and type: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;ps ux&#124;grep [S]ecretSync&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If SecretSync is still running somewhere, you will see something like the following: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;user  6750   0.0  1.6   863364  33612   ??  S     2:52PM   0:01.69 java -jar SecretSync.jar&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;You can kill the process by using the &#60;code&#62;kill&#60;/code&#62; command with the second number above, &#60;code&#62;6750&#60;/code&#62;, which is the process ID. Yours will likely be a different number.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;kill -9 6750&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(3) The SecretSync application is installed into a hidden folder under your home folder named &#60;code&#62;.secretsync&#60;/code&#62;. To remove this folder completely from your system, type the following command in &#60;code&#62;Terminal&#60;/code&#62; - &#60;strong&#62;CAUTION, this command cannot be undone.&#60;/strong&#62; Do this only if you are sure all the previous steps have been successfully completed.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;rm -fr $HOME/.secretsync&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(4) Now, remove the SecretSync folder, where you have stored your data. &#60;strong&#62;Step 1 above must be done first, or you could lose all your data&#60;/strong&#62;. Paste the following into Terminal: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;rm -r $HOME/SecretSync&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Note: This assumes that you installed your SecretSync folder into its default location under the home folder. If you installed it elsewhere, you will need to use &#60;code&#62;rm -r /Alternate/Path/To/SecretSync&#60;/code&#62; but be aware the results are the same, i.e. you can't undelete these files.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(5) Check that the folders and files have been removed. Still in the Terminal, type&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;ls -alF $HOME/.secretsync; ls -alF $HOME/SecretSync&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;You should get get a &#60;code&#62;No such file or directory&#60;/code&#62; message for both.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;(6) OPTIONAL. Only do this step if you want SecretSync removed completely from Dropbox as well. If you only want to uninstall SecretSync from the current computer and let other computers continue synchronizing, &#60;strong&#62;do not do this step&#60;/strong&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;To remove all traces of SecretSync, perform the final deletion: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;code&#62;rm -fr $HOME/Dropbox/.SecretSync_tunnel_Root&#60;/code&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;This will remove the tunnel folder from Dropbox, which will then synchronize those changes to your other computers.

<description>&#60;p&#62;SecretSync has no logic to handle proxy servers in its code. As a Java application it relies entirely on the Java runtime proxy settings. Information about configuring the proxy for the Java runtime are here:&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;http://www.java.com/en/download/help/proxy_setup.xml&#34;&#62;http://www.java.com/en/download/help/proxy_setup.xml&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;On startup, SecretSync makes a couple https calls to the below URL.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;&#60;a href=&#34;https://www.completelyprivatefiles.com/services/secretsync/db/&#34;&#62;https://www.completelyprivatefiles.com/services/secretsync/db/&#60;/a&#62;&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;It does this to exchange your token for an encryption key. It makes no other connections after this point. If it can't connect to the server, the application cannot continue, and will exit.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;If your browser uses a proxy, and you put the above URL in your browser and you can connect, you might consider setting the Java runtime to &#60;strong&#62;Use browser settings&#60;/strong&#62;.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Some proxies are 'filtering proxies' which means that they may block (1) certain sites, and (2) certain applications, such as Java from Internet access. This means that simply because your browser can access our site, Java may still not be able to. Because of the many possible configurations and proxy solutions, we can only provide limited support for proxy issues.
